The Connection Between Railroad Work and Throat Cancer
Throat cancer, particularly squamous cell cancer, is a kind of cancer that develops in the cells lining the throat and throat. This condition has actually been linked to a number of danger elements, consisting of tobacco use, excessive alcohol usage, and exposure to particular chemicals. When it comes to railroad employees, the direct exposure to hazardous substances in time has actually raised issue relating to a potential connection with throat cancer.
Possible Hazards in the Railroad Industry
Railroad employees are often exposed to a variety of harmful compounds that might increase the danger of developing throat cancer. These dangerous products consist of:
Asbestos: Historically utilized for insulation and fireproofing, asbestos fibers can become air-borne and breathed in by workers, increasing cancer risk.Benzene: Found in diesel exhaust and other chemicals, benzene direct exposure is linked to different health problems, consisting of specific types of cancer.Formaldehyde: This compound, typically found in different industrial processes and materials, can trigger respiratory problems and has actually been categorized as a human carcinogen.
The extended exposure to these substances raises the stakes for railroad workers, making them vulnerable to serious health concerns, consisting of throat cancer.
Legal Recourse: Understanding Railroad Settlements
Victims of throat cancer potentially triggered by [Railroad Settlement Cll](https://virtualghana.com/author/railroad-settlement-reactive-airway-disease1059/) work may pursue legal settlement through settlements. Legal option might depend upon the specific scenarios surrounding their case, including the type of direct exposure and the employer's neglect. The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A) enables railroad workers to file claims against their companies for work-related injuries or health problems.

Yes, there is a statute of restrictions for suing under FELA, usually three years from the date of the injury or from when the employee ended up being conscious of the health problem.
